Job description

Job ID# 1685
StraCon Services Group, LLC is seeking a Program/Project Management Analyst, Senior in Patuxent River MD. The Program/Project Management Analyst, Senior will be responsible for but no limited to the following requirements. 

Essential Job Duties:
  • Applies analytic techniques in the evaluation of program/project objectives.
  • Analyzes requirements, status, budget and schedules. Performs management, technical, and business case analyses.
  • Collects, completes, organizes and interprets data relating to aircraft/weapon/project acquisition and product programs.
  • Tracks program/project status and schedules.
  • Assists program leadership in formulating and delivering strategic messaging and required reports.
  • May develop and submit briefing materials on behalf of the Program Office.
  • Assist the project IPT lead with industry partners in communicating a message consistent with Program Office strategic goals and intent.
  • Skilled in managing competing priorities, deadlines and projects
  • Serves as a qualified professional in technical writing and strategic messaging.
Travel Requirements:
  • ​N/A
Experience Requirements:
  • Senior - over 10 years of experience performing duties described in the functional description, with at least 5 of those years successfully managing technology development with Electronic Warfare (EW) programs.
Desired Experience:
  • At least ten (10) years of experience in NAVAIR program management, technical, and business analysis discipline, related to acquisition and life cycle management; and a minimum of six (6) years out of 10 years of recent work experience related to analysis and planning. Demonstrated experience in program/project status, earned value management, schedules, strategic communications and technical writing.
Education Requirements:
  • MA/MS degree
  • Allowable Substitution for MA/MS Degree:
    • Bachelor’s Degree plus two (2) years additional work experience performing duties described in the functional description of the labor category may be substituted for a Master’s Degree. OR:
    • Associate’s Degree plus four (4) years additional work experience performing duties described in the functional description of the labor category may be substituted for a Master’s Degree. OR:
    • Six (6) years additional work experience performing duties described in the functional description of the labor category may be substituted for a Master’s Degree.
Security Requirements:
  • U.S. Citizenship required.
  • TS/SCI
